The Atlanta Falcons are concluding their pre-draft visits ahead of the 2025 NFL draft. LSU edge prospect Bradyn Swinson is among the final prospects to visit the Falcons, as reported by NFL Network's Ian Rapoport. Swinson, a Day 2 projected pick, showcased strong pass-rushing abilities with nine sacks and 43 hurries in the 2024 season.
Additionally, the Falcons met with William and Mary offensive lineman Charles Grant to address the hole left at the center position. Grant, known for his versatility, may transition from left tackle to guard or center in the NFL. With an impressive overall PFF grade of 91.2 in 2024, Grant offers potential solutions for the Falcons' offensive line needs.
